Sleep Tracking Apps and Their Health Benefits
Sleep tracking apps play a vital role in health tracking by monitoring sleep patterns and providing insights to improve overall wellness.
These innovative tools leverage technology to collect and analyze data on sleep durations and cycles, which can be invaluable for users seeking to enhance their rest quality. By employing smart technology, these applications often assess various factors such as movement, heart rate, and even ambient noise levels that may affect sleep.
Notable examples of sleep tracking apps include:
- Sleep Cycle: This app utilizes sound analysis to monitor sleep patterns and offers a smart alarm feature that wakes users during the lightest sleep phase, promoting a more refreshing start to the day.
- Fitbit: Known mostly for its fitness tracking, it also provides detailed sleep analytics, allowing users to visualize their sleep stages and receive personalized tips for improvement.
- Pillow: This app combines sleep tracking with heart rate monitoring using Apple Watch to provide insights about overall health and well-being.
By understanding sleep dynamics and implementing suggested changes, users can experience profound improvements in their daily energy levels and emotional resilience.

Compatibility with Devices and Technology Stack
Ensuring compatibility with various devices, including wearable devices and smartphones, is vital for the effectiveness of fitness tracker apps.
This compatibility directly influences both the functionality of the apps and the overall user experience, as the right technology stack can enhance performance.
For instance, when users sync their fitness tracker apps with smartwatches, they can receive real-time notifications, monitor heart rates, and even track sleep patterns seamlessly.
Popular integrations, such as those with Apple Health and Google Fit, enhance this experience by consolidating data from different devices into a single interface.
- Apple Watch allows users to access fitness data while on the go.
- Fitbit devices provide in-depth analytics for workouts and health metrics.
- Garmin watches sync easily with various apps to help maintain performance logs.
Such integrations not only improve tracking but also foster a more engaged fitness journey.

Set Realistic Goals
Setting realistic goals is essential for maintaining user motivation and achieving success in your fitness journey with tracker apps.
Establishing achievable targets not only provides direction but also fosters a sense of accomplishment as progress is made. When individuals begin their fitness endeavors, they often dream big, but such lofty aspirations can lead to disappointment. Instead, seeking incremental improvements, like a gradual increase in workout duration or intensity, helps build confidence and resilience.
- For example, rather than aiming to run a marathon in a month, focusing on completing a 5K can be more realistic.
- Setting a specific target of 30 minutes of exercise five times a week can create a manageable and sustainable pattern.
Pitfalls like comparing oneself to others or setting overly ambitious timelines can derail motivation quickly, making it crucial to celebrate each small victory along the path to fitness success.

5. Can I use a fitness tracker app if I don't have a device like a smartwatch?
Yes, you can still use a fitness tracker app without a smartwatch or other wearable device. Many apps have the option to manually input your activity, such as the number of steps or type of exercise, for tracking purposes. You can also use your phone's built-in sensors to track your movement.
